The UK Independent Schools’ Directory has more than 2000 independent schools listed, covering an age range of 3 months to 20 years. It is possible to search for a day or boarding school, single sex or co-educational school, preparatory or senior school, a particular religious affiliation or to view the independent schools listed in a specific county.
